What to compare in a Tema freight forwarding provider
Choosing the right freight forwarding service in Tema starts with comparing how each provider handles the full cargo journey, not just the pickup. Look for a provider that explains responsibilities clearly, including who submits which documents and when. This reduces confusion at the port and helps your shipment move with fewer delays.
Compare their network and operational coverage as well, because freight forwarding is only as strong as the routes and partners behind it. Ask about their handling of different shipment types, such as containerized cargo, breakbulk, and time-sensitive consignments. A strong provider should also describe communication standards, including shipment tracking updates and escalation steps if problems arise. When services are well structured, your procurement and sales teams can plan with greater confidence.

Cost, speed, and risk: comparing total logistics value
Price comparisons should focus on total landed value rather than a single line-item charge. Some providers offer low base rates but add surcharges later for warehouse handling, inspection support, or rerouting. Request a transparent breakdown that includes port-related charges, inland trucking, storage, and administrative fees. This lets you compare like-for-like and understand what you are truly paying for.
Speed is also a key differentiator, but it should be measured in processes, not promises. Ask how each provider plans booking windows, manages container dwell time, and coordinates with port stakeholders. Evaluate how they handle exceptions such as incomplete documentation, cargo delays, or customs queries. The best options reduce risk by building contingency plans and maintaining a clear chain of responsibility.
